This is a Call for Review of a proposed charter for the Web
Authentication Working Group:
https://www.w3.org/2019/08/webauthn-proposed-charter.html
This updated charter continues work on Level 2 of the WebAuthn API. Diff
from previous version is available at [1].
[...]
The proposed staff contact time is 0.05 FTE.
Note that the Working Group will be meeting at TPAC 2019. The Working
Group's current charter [2] is extended through 30 October, 2019, to
accommodate for the charter review period.
